The Giovanni Canonica Barolo Paiagallo 2018, from Italy’s Piedmont region, is a magnificent Barolo DOCG. Crafted from 100% Nebbiolo, it displays an intense garnet red hue. Its complex bouquet reveals withered rose, violet, liquorice, and earthy notes. On the palate, it’s austere, powerful, with elegant tannins and a long mineral finish. Aged traditionally in large oak barrels, it's perfect with rich red meats and aged cheeses, served at 18-20°C.

Colour
Intense garnet red with orange reflections.
Bouquet
Complex, ethereal, notes of withered rose, violet, liquorice, sweet spices, truffle, and goudron.
Taste
Austere, powerful, great structure and persistence, elegant yet vigorous tannins, long, mineral finish.
Alcohol content
14.5% vol.
Type of glass
Large goblet, Burgundy or Barolo type.
Pairings
Important red meats (braised, roasted), game, truffle, aged cheeses.
Refinement
Long aging in large oak barrels, then in bottle. Min. 38 months, 18 in wood.
Vinification
Traditional fermentation with long maceration on skins, in wooden or steel vats.
